| /* See LICENSE file for copyright and license details. */ |
| #include <stdlib.h> |
| #include <string.h> |
| |
| #include "../util.h" |
| |
| void * |
| ecalloc(size_t nmemb, size_t size) |
| { |
| return encalloc(1, nmemb, size); |
| } |
| |
| void * |
| emalloc(size_t size) |
| { |
| return enmalloc(1, size); |
| } |
| |
| void * |
| erealloc(void *p, size_t size) |
| { |
| return enrealloc(1, p, size); |
| } |
| |
| char * |
| estrdup(const char *s) |
| { |
| return enstrdup(1, s); |
| } |
| |
| char * |
| estrndup(const char *s, size_t n) |
| { |
| return enstrndup(1, s, n); |
| } |
| |
| void * |
| encalloc(int status, size_t nmemb, size_t size) |
| { |
| void *p; |
| |
| p = calloc(nmemb, size); |
| if (!p) |
| enprintf(status, "calloc: out of memory\n"); |
| return p; |
| } |
| |
| void * |
| enmalloc(int status, size_t size) |
| { |
| void *p; |
| |
| p = malloc(size); |
| if (!p) |
| enprintf(status, "malloc: out of memory\n"); |
| return p; |
| } |
| |
| void * |
| enrealloc(int status, void *p, size_t size) |
| { |
| p = realloc(p, size); |
| if (!p) |
| enprintf(status, "realloc: out of memory\n"); |
| return p; |
| } |
| |
| char * |
| enstrdup(int status, const char *s) |
| { |
| char *p; |
| |
| p = strdup(s); |
| if (!p) |
| enprintf(status, "strdup: out of memory\n"); |
| return p; |
| } |
| |
| char * |
| enstrndup(int status, const char *s, size_t n) |
| { |
| char *p; |
| |
| p = strndup(s, n); |
| if (!p) |
| enprintf(status, "strndup: out of memory\n"); |
| return p; |
| } |
